190: Chapter 190: The Three Demon Kings
Outside the Sword Qi Great Wall, in the Grey Stone Wasteland.
At Captain Zhao's command, everyone began to retreat.
The lowest cultivation level among this group was the Nascent Soul Stage; upon hearing the order to retreat, they immediately displayed their respective divine abilities.
Everyone turned into streaks of light, racing toward the Sword Qi Great Wall.
The Monster Hunting Team was even more efficient, being seasoned veterans of the battlefield.
The moment they heard the command, everyone transformed into Sword Shields and sped away.
This was a standardized Escape Technique of the Sword Qi Great Wall. By rapidly changing formations, the Sword Shields spread out in a fan shape, forming a massive defensive array to protect the Loose Cultivators in the center.
At the rear of the crowd was Captain Zhao.
Riding his Black-Scaled Tiger, he followed steadily at the back of the group with simple, long strides.
Captain Zhao sat backward on the black tiger, his greyish-white eyes scanning the surroundings, his scarred face appearing particularly menacing amidst the wind and sand.
"Everyone, don't hold back! Pick up the pace!"
At the very front of the crowd, Old Liu shouted at the top of his lungs, his body glowing with dark red spiritual light as he further accelerated.
Beside him, three team members each held their Magical Artifacts, similarly burning their essence blood to increase their speed.
Among the crowd, Loose Cultivators were scattered in small groups; some flew on swords, some rode Spirit Beasts, and others utilized movement techniques.
In short, everyone was showing off their unique skills.
Everyone knew that they absolutely could not fall behind at a time like this, or death would be the only outcome.
Li Changsheng and Su Qinghan blended into the crowd, pushing their Escape Techniques to the limit.
Dressed in a green robe, Li Changsheng moved with his hands behind his back, his Divine Sense fully extended to cover a radius of a hundred zhang.
Su Qinghan, in white clothes as pure as snow, held a long sword. A thin layer of frost had condensed on the blade, radiating a biting chill.
She looked back at the distant rift valley from time to time, her brow slightly furrowed.
"Junior Brother Li."
She suddenly spoke.
Li Changsheng turned his head. "Hmm?"
"Do you feel like something's wrong?"
"We've been running for so long, yet we still haven't seen the Sword Qi Great Wall."
Li Changsheng was startled.
"You mean... we're trapped in a Domain?"
Su Qinghan didn't answer, only tightening her grip on her sword.
Just then.
Captain Zhao, who had been at the rear, suddenly moved to the very front.
The Black-Scaled Tiger let out a sudden, low roar, commanding everyone to stop.
The group halted instantly, everyone looking toward Captain Zhao in unison.
Captain Zhao's greyish-white eyes were fixed on the distant horizon.
There, the wind and sand filled the sky, blotting out the sun.
"Stop running,"
he said in a heavy voice.
Old Liu approached. "Captain, what's wrong?"
Captain Zhao didn't answer, instead pulling a bronze-colored compass from his robes.
The compass was covered in dense runes, and the needle in the center was spinning wildly, unable to stabilize.
"We've been ambushed."
"There's a Domain here set up by Yao Kings. Everyone, form a formation!"
No sooner had he spoken.
The space ahead suddenly distorted violently.
A black light barrier descended from the sky, enveloping the entire team.
Strange blood-red runes flowed across the light barrier, emitting a suffocating Demonic Qi.
At the edges of the barrier, space looked like torn cloth, revealing the greyish-black Void Realm within.
"It really is a Domain! A Domain of three Yao Kings!"
Old Liu's expression changed.
He knew all too well how terrifying Void Refinement Stage experts were, and the enemy had come prepared.
It looked like their chances of survival were slim this time!
At the very front of the crowd, Captain Zhao remained calm.
Even though they had been ambushed, he didn't show a hint of panic.
Because panic served no purpose and might even lead to their total annihilation.
Captain Zhao paused for a moment, then urged the Black-Scaled Tiger beneath him to charge at the light barrier.
The Black-Scaled Tiger's paws kicked up wind as it turned into a black shadow and crashed headlong into the barrier.
The light barrier didn't budge, but the Black-Scaled Tiger was bounced back.
It shook its head slightly at Captain Zhao.
Captain Zhao immediately said in a low voice,
"Yao Kings of the Void Refinement Stage, at least three of them."
From within the crowd,
a Loose Cultivator at the Nascent Soul Stage shouted in terror.
"Three Yao Kings? Doesn't that mean we're dead for sure?"
An old man beside him slapped him on the head.
"Shut up! We're not dead yet!".
Another Monster Hunting Team member at the Peak Soul Transformation Stage summoned a Bronze Mirror. The mirror suspended in mid-air, firing a beam of golden light that struck the barrier.
The golden light was like a clay ox entering the sea, vanishing without a trace.
"My Restriction-Breaking Mirror didn't even cause a ripple?"
This meant that aside from Captain Zhao, who was also at the Void Refinement Stage, no one else could possibly break this light barrier.
Captain Zhao ignored this, took a Jade Talisman from his robes, and crushed it.
The Jade Talisman turned into a golden light and soared toward the sky.
In an instant, it blasted a tiny crack in the barrier, but the crack healed immediately.
"Even the Transmission Talisman can't get out; this Domain isolates everything."
Old Liu gripped his blood-drinking blade.
"Captain, what do we do?"
Captain Zhao remained silent for a moment, then looked up beyond the light barrier.
There, three massive figures were taking shape.
First to appear was a giant tiger, golden all over.
It was ten zhang long, its body covered in golden scales. Each scale was like a small shield, glinting blindingly in the sunlight.
On its forehead was the pattern of the character 'King', within which golden flames flickered, emitting a suffocating pressure.
It was the Overlord Tiger.
It raised a paw and stepped down lightly.
The earth trembled, splitting into countless fissures, as debris flew everywhere.
Next, a black shadow spiraled down from the sky, transforming into a pitch-black giant python.
The Netherworld Python coiled to the left of the Overlord Tiger, its body slowly writhing with a rustling sound.
Finally, a flash of white light appeared.
A snow-white giant wolf landed to the right of the Overlord Tiger.
The giant wolf was five zhang long with silver fur. Each hair stood up like a steel needle, radiating a bone-chilling cold.
The Frost Wolf King.
The three Yao Kings stood together, their hundred-zhang-tall bodies blotting out the sun and surrounding the entire team.
Their Demonic Qi surged like a tide, making it hard for everyone to breathe.
Captain Zhao, riding the Black-Scaled Tiger, looked up at the three Yao Kings.
"I wondered who it was."
"So it's you three losers. A hundred years ago, the Lord should have killed all of you."
The Overlord Tiger looked down at him, a hint of wariness flashing in its golden vertical pupils.
Clearly, the "Lord" Captain Zhao mentioned had left an indelible impression on it.
However, that trace of wariness was quickly replaced by mockery.
"Old Man Zhao, you're on the brink of death, yet you're still so stubborn."
"How many of my kin have your Human Race killed? Today, it's time to pay the debt."
Its voice was like thunder, making everyone's eardrums ache.
Captain Zhao sneered.
"Pay the debt? You Yao Race invaded human territory, killing, burning, and plundering resources. You deserved to be killed."
"Heh... Stubborn!"
